The company is experiencing strong growth, with 62% of total orders placed in 2025. While the order completion rate is solid at 60%, there is a notable share of cancelled (25%) and incomplete (15%) orders. A deep-dive analysis reveals that clients are responsible for 61% of failed orders, with "Customer Cancelled" being the top reason.
The analysis highlights several operational inefficiencies and market-specific trends, providing opportunities for process improvements and targeted customer engagement.
Order Growth:
62% of all orders occurred in 2025, showing clear year-over-year expansion.
Order Status Distribution:
Monthly Trends:
Order volumes fluctuate monthly, with a sharp drop in May 2025βpotentially due to seasonal or operational factors.
Yearly Improvement:
Completed orders increased significantly in 2025 (35% of total), showing progress in fulfillment performance.